How much does a Ultrasound Technologist make in Fairbanks, AK?
An Ultrasound Technologist in Fairbanks, AK, can earn a good salary. On average, the yearly salary is around $114,352. This means that, typically, Ultrasound Technologists can expect to make this amount each year. Many factors can affect this number, like experience and the specific employer.
Here are some details about the salary range for Ultrasound Technologists in Fairbanks, AK:
- The lowest 10% earn about $69,920.
- The next 20% make between $69,920 and $88,407.
- The middle 20% earn between $88,407 and $106,895.
- The next 20% make between $106,895 and $125,382.
- The highest 10% earn more than $143,869.
These numbers show a broad range, giving a clear picture of what one might expect to earn at different points in a career.
